The physical form varies by preparation type: whole almonds retain their natural skin and shape; blanched almonds have the skin removed through hot water treatment and mechanical abrasion; roasted almonds undergo dry heat processing for flavour development. Standard industry moisture content for shelled almonds typically falls between 4% and 6% to prevent rancidity and mould growth. Free fatty acid levels, a key indicator of rancidity, normally measure below 1.5% for export-grade material. The aflatoxin B1 limit for almonds entering EU markets is strictly regulated at 2 micrograms per kilogram for ready-to-eat product and 8 micrograms per kilogram for further processing. Packaging typically involves vacuum-sealed or nitrogen-flushed bags within corrugated cartons to preserve shelf stability during transit.

Before placing an order with Ponik Holding Sp. Z.O.O., verify the company's legal registration in Poland, including KRS number and VAT identification. Request a current certificate of analysis for the specific lot you intend to purchase, covering aflatoxin, moisture, free fatty acids, and microbiological parameters. Ask for two recent customer references with contact details, and confirm whether the supplier holds active product liability insurance. Given the zero response rate, initiate contact through multiple channels and document all communications before sending deposits.
Logistics arrangements require explicit confirmation. Ask whether shipments depart from Gdansk, Gdynia, or another Polish port, and what the typical transit time is to your destination. Confirm whether the supplier handles export customs clearance or expects the buyer to arrange this. For Incoterms, establish whether quoted prices are FOB, CIF, or another term, and whether these include palletisation and container sealing. Payment via letter of credit offers more security than T/T advance, though banks charge accordingly. If advance payment is unavoidable, consider using an escrow structure or starting with a small trial shipment.
Quality verification on arrival should include sampling per ISO 2859 or your own AQL protocol. Inspect for moisture damage, insect infestation, off-odours indicating rancidity, and correct grade versus what was ordered. Request that the supplier provides phytosanitary and health certificates consistent with destination country requirements. For EU entry, ensure compliance with Regulation 2015/93 on maximum residue levels and appropriate allergen labelling. Retain samples from each delivery batch for dispute resolution, and agree upfront on arbitration jurisdiction should quality disputes arise.
